Wendy and other prospective carvers, I recommend finding a "chop" near you aand seeing if one of the attendees would be willing to "take you under their wing" so to speak. If you don't live near anyplace that regularly hosts a chop, plan a trip. Contact some TC chop participant in say, San Diego, and see if they can supply you with wood to make a mask (or something that travels easily if you are taking a plane) , find out what chisels and tools to get , plan a design and have fun.
In my case, I got lucky and a friend (Billy the Crud) was in town, I hosted the chop, he took me under his wing and (when he wasn't using them) I was able to borrow his tools. I hope this helps. -smiley
